#45ed61 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#45ed61 is composed of 27.1% red, 92.9%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.1%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 130 degrees, a saturation of 82.4% and a lightness of 60%. #45ed61 color hex could be obtained by blending #8affc2 with #00db00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

#45ed61 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#45ed61 has RGB values of R:69, G:237,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 4582753.
